MCN: Crusty Demons Night of World Records jump-off

Robbie Maddison has beaten his own jumping Guinness World Record at the Crusty Demons Night of World Records in Australia. Maddison leaped his CR500 an astonishing 351 feet, adding 29 feet to his previous world record at the three-way jump-off between Maddison, Ryan Capes and Seth Enslow at Calder Park, Melbourne. Rival stunt rider Ryan Capes held the record for a short period after jumping 324 feet (beating the old record of 322 feet), but Maddison pulled out the stops to claim the record. Maddison told MCN: "I can't explain how amazing it is to smash my own world record in front of a home crowd. I have been doing huge jumps and breaking personal records in training this week so I knew that I had it tonight, but nothing could of prepared me for how great this feels."
